Flat Roof Inspection Questions
What is involved in a flat roof inspection? An inspection typically includes checking for signs of damage, ponding water, membrane condition, and drainage issues to assess the roof’s overall health.
Why are regular flat roof inspections important? Regular inspections help identify potential problems early, preventing costly repairs and extending the roof’s lifespan.
What signs indicate a flat roof needs repairs? Common signs include water stains, blistering, cracks, pooling water, or visible damage to the roofing material.
How often should a flat ro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a flat roof inspected at least once a year and after severe weather events.
